Description

Methyl o-toluate is widely utilized in research focused on:

Fragrance Industry: This compound is commonly used as a fragrance ingredient in perfumes and cosmetics, providing a pleasant floral scent that enhances product appeal.

Flavoring Agent: It serves as a flavoring agent in food products, contributing to the taste profile of various culinary items, particularly in confectionery and baked goods.

Solvent Applications: Methyl o-toluate acts as a solvent in paint and coatings, helping to dissolve other substances and improve the application properties of products.

Pharmaceuticals: In the pharmaceutical industry, it is used as an intermediate in the synthesis of various medicinal compounds, aiding in the development of effective drugs.

Research and Development: It is utilized in laboratories for organic synthesis and analytical chemistry, allowing researchers to explore new chemical reactions and develop innovative materials.
